#### 9 Development of land
9 Development of land
> > (1) This section does not apply to contaminated land.
>
> > (2) The owner of land that is part of the former smelter site—
> >
> > > (a) is to facilitate the development of the land, and
> >
> > > (b) if the owner is not a development corporation, has and may exercise development corporation functions in relation to the land, and
> >
> > > (c) even if the owner is a development corporation, does not require an approval under section 11 of the [Growth Centres (Development Corporations) Act 1974](/view/html/inforce/current/act-1974-049) to exercise any development corporation function in relation to the land.
>
> > (3) An owner of land that is part of the former smelter site may enter into an agreement with a person to sell the land to that person without first making the land available for public sale if the person—
> >
> > > (a) had, immediately before the notification day, a contract to purchase land forming part of the former smelter site, or
> >
> > > (b) had, before the notification day, engaged in negotiations to purchase land forming part of the former smelter site with the owner of the land.
>
> > (4) In this section—
> >
> > development corporation functions, in relation to land, means the functions that a development corporation has under the [Growth Centres (Development Corporations) Act 1974](/view/html/inforce/current/act-1974-049) in relation to land forming part of the growth centre in respect of which the development corporation is constituted.
